程序员

Flex 关于字体的应用示例介绍

作者:admin 2021-04-12 我要评论

Flex4.5,为了使项目能正确美化字体,并消除字体的锯齿,先把字体文件FZHTJW.TTF放入到项目中 复制代码 代码如下: fx:Style @namespace s "library://ns.adobe.c...

在说正事之前,我要推荐一个福利:你还在原价购买阿里云、腾讯云、华为云服务器吗?那太亏啦!来这里,新购、升级、续费都打折,能够为您省60%的钱呢!2核4G企业级云服务器低至69元/年,点击进去看看吧>>>)
Flex4.5,为了使项目能正确美化字体,并消除字体的锯齿,先把字体文件FZHTJW.TTF放入到项目中
复制代码 代码如下:

<fx:Style>
@namespace s "library://ns.adobe.com/flex/spark";
@namespace mx "library://ns.adobe.com/flex/mx";
@font-face{
src:url("assets/Fonts/FZHTJW.TTF");
fontFamily: FZHTJT; /* 嵌入后的字体名称,也就是程序中要应用的字体 */
fontStyle: normal;/* 常用值:normal, italic */
fontWeight: normal; /* 常用值:normal, bold */
advancedAntiAliasing: true; /* 是否消除锯齿 */
fontAntiAliasType:advanced; }
</fx:Style>

复制代码 代码如下:

<s:Label x="343" y="55" fontFamily="FZHTJT" fontSize="18" text="三国集团"/>

fontFamily 应用嵌入后字体的名称FZHTJT
可以建立多个@font-face{} 使用多种字体,注既然在嵌入式中用了fontWeight和fontStyle,那在组件里就别再重复使用此属性,否则无效。

可以把@font-face{} 保存在CSS文件中,然后通过CSS编译成SWF文件,在应用程序中调用FontAssets.swf
复制代码 代码如下:

@font-face{
src:url("FontAssets.swf");
fontFamily:FZHTJT;
}

本文转载自网络,原文链接:https://m.jb51.net/article/40958.htm

版权声明:本文转载自网络,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。本站转载出于传播更多优秀技术知识之目的,如有侵权请联系QQ/微信:153890879删除

相关文章
  • 四两拨千斤——你不知道的VScode编码Ty

    四两拨千斤——你不知道的VScode编码Ty

  • 我是如何在 Vue 项目中做代码分割的

    我是如何在 Vue 项目中做代码分割的

  • position:sticky 粘性定位的几种巧妙应

    position:sticky 粘性定位的几种巧妙应

  • 从零到一搭建React组件库

    从零到一搭建React组件库